Which rules apply to you
Waterman is one of 12 incorporated places in DeKalb County, a county of about 100,000 people. The county's largest is DeKalb, about 11.3 miles away.
Coverage itself is set statewide, not locally. Illinois Medicaid covers medically necessary ABA for eligible children anywhere in Illinois, and Illinois’s autism insurance law reaches private plans issued in the state. Your address changes which providers can reach you — it doesn’t change whether you’re covered.
